Myslice Login: MySlice is the student portal for Syracuse University. It provides students with access to a wide range of information and resources related to their enrollment, coursework, and university life.

Some of the features available through MySlice include:

  • Personal information: students can view and update their personal information, such as contact details and emergency contacts.
  • Financial information: students can view their billing statements, financial aid information, and make payments.
  • Academic information: students can view their class schedules, grades, and transcripts.
  • Campus resources: students can access information about university services, such as housing, dining, and campus events.

To access MySlice, students will need to log in with their Syracuse University netID and password. If you are having trouble logging in, you may want to contact the Syracuse University Information Technology Services (ITS) help desk for assistance.

Myslice SUmail Account (Syracuse University Email)

SUMail is the official email service for students, faculty, and staff at Syracuse University. All Syracuse University students are assigned a SUMail account, which they can use to communicate with their professors, classmates, and university administrators.

SUMail is accessible through the MySlice portal and is powered by Google’s Gmail service. This means that students can use all of the features and tools that are available through Gmail, such as email, calendar, contacts, and more.

To log into your SUMail account, you will need to use your Syracuse University netID and password. If you are having trouble accessing your SUMail account, you may want to contact the Syracuse University Information Technology Services (ITS) help desk for assistance.

Myslice Login

To log into the MySlice portal at Syracuse University, follow these steps:

  1. Open a web browser and go to the MySlice login page at https://my.syr.edu
  2. Enter your Syracuse University netID in the “Username” field.
  3. Enter your Syracuse University password in the “Password” field.
  4. Click the “Sign In” button to access your MySlice account.

If you are having trouble logging in, you may want to check the following:

  • Ensure that you are entering your netID and password correctly.
  • Make sure that you have an active Syracuse University network account.
  • Check to see if your account has been locked due to too many incorrect login attempts. If this is the case, you may need to wait a few minutes and then try logging in again.

If you continue to have trouble logging into MySlice, you may want to contact the Syracuse University Information Technology Services (ITS) help desk for assistance.

Reset Forgot The Sign In Password Or User Id

If you have forgotten your Syracuse University netID or password, you can reset it by following these steps:

  1. Go to the Syracuse University Account Management page at https://account.syr.edu.
  2. Click on the “Forgot netID?” or “Forgot password?” link, depending on which one you need to reset.
  3. Follow the instructions on the page to reset your netID or password. This may involve answering security questions or providing personal information to verify your identity.

If you are unable to reset your netID or password using the account management page, you may need to contact the Syracuse University Information Technology Services (ITS) help desk for assistance. They will be able to help you reset your password and get you back into your MySlice account.

Guidance Activate Syracuse MySlice

To activate your Syracuse University MySlice account, you will need to follow these steps:

  1. Go to the Syracuse University Account Management page at https://account.syr.edu.
  2. Click on the “Activate your account” button.
  3. Enter the required information, including your name, date of birth, and Syracuse University ID number.
  4. Follow the instructions on the screen to activate your account and set your password.
  5. Once you have activated your account and set your password, you can log into the MySlice portal at https://my.syr.edu using your Syracuse University netID and password.

If you are having trouble activating your MySlice account, you may need to contact the Syracuse University Information Technology Services (ITS) help desk for assistance. They will be able to help you activate your account and get you started with using MySlice.

Syracuse University Contact Support

If you need help with any technology-related issues at Syracuse University, you can contact the Information Technology Services (ITS) support center for assistance. There are several ways to reach ITS:

  1. Phone: You can call the ITS help desk at 315-443-2677.
  2. Email: You can send an email to itshelp@syr.edu and a support representative will respond to your request.
  3. Online: You can submit a request for help through the ITS website at https://www.syracuse.edu/admissions/undergraduate/contact/.
  4. In-person: You can visit the ITS walk-in center in Room 010 of the Computing Services Center, located at 105 University Place.

ITS support is available 24/7 to assist you with any technology-related issues you may encounter while at Syracuse University.
